(Times of Israel) Israel attempted to use tapes of former US president Bill Clinton's steamy conversations with intern Monica Lewinsky to leverage the release of Jonathan Pollard, a new book on the Clinton family's political enterprises has claimed. In the book, titled "Clinton Inc: The Audacious Rebuilding of a Political Machine," author Daniel Halper relies on on-the-record interviews with former officials together with a close analysis of documents termed "the Monica Files" to paint a salacious – and uncomplimentary – picture of one of the most prominent political families in the United States.
